Specifications

18 tracked specs across 7 groups · 2 specifications have a field-level source citation.

Platform

Architecture
RDNA 4 Navi 48 Needs confirmation
Process Node
TSMC N4P Needs confirmation

Memory

Memory
16GB Needs confirmation
Memory Type
GDDR6 Source cited
Memory Bus
256-bit Source cited
Memory Bandwidth
640 GB/s Needs confirmation

Compute

Shader / CUDA Cores
3584 stream processors Needs confirmation
Boost Clock
Up to 2.52 GHz Needs confirmation

Power

Typical Board Power
220W Needs confirmation
Recommended PSU
650W Needs confirmation
Power Connectors
2x 8-pin Needs confirmation

Gaming

Ray Tracing
3rd-gen AMD RT Needs confirmation
Upscaling
FSR 4 Needs confirmation
Frame Generation
AMD Fluid Motion Frames 2 Needs confirmation
Target Resolution
1440p high refresh Needs confirmation

Connectivity

Display Outputs
DisplayPort 2.1a, HDMI 2.1b Needs confirmation
Interface
PCIe 5.0 x16 Needs confirmation

Physical

Card Length Class
Mainstream dual-slot class Needs confirmation
